While Argentina is mostly known for their Malbec, other noted Argentinian wines are composed of Cabernet Sauvignon, Bonarda, Torrontes and other varietals. The Mendoza Province is the largest wine producing area in South America and provides the ideal growing conditions for this wide variety of grapes. Mendoza wines benefit from the high altitude and mountain climate of these vineyards and are typically rich, fruit-forward and aromatic.
